Create a peaceful oasis by simplifying the color palette and decor

Although they’re often underestimated, small bedroom tweaks can make a world of difference. Covering the walls with a fresh coat of paint or decorating with simple yet interesting ornaments make for low budget bedroom tweaks that can completely transform the feel of the space.

Since your bedroom is the place for relaxing and unwinding, it’d be best to stick with a neutral colour palette, avoiding overstimulating colors and over-the-top decor pieces. This will help you reduce sensory overload and create a peaceful bedroom environment while at the same time boosting its aesthetic appearance.

For smaller bedrooms, pick lighter neutrals – they will make the room feel brighter and more spacious. Larger bedrooms can benefit from using darker hues. Varying the textures will enrich your space and add depth to it while decluttering and rearranging bedroom furniture will go a long way in boosting the functionality and flow of the bedroom.

Design a comfy reading nook in your master bedroom

In case you’re working with a larger master bedroom, you might be thinking about how you can put the extra space to good use. For avid readers, having a comfy nook where you can relax and unwind with a cup of tea and a good book is sometimes all you need after a long day at work, and designing one is rather simple.

Start by selecting comfy furniture– it can be anything from sofas to armchairs to recliner chairs. Place it in the corner of the master bedroom and add a small coffee table with a night lamp and a couple of pillows. You can really be creative here and design the space you can read in peace without disturbing your partner.

Up the coziness in your bedroom with cozy floor covering

A bedroom should be a place that exudes comfort and warmth. As one of the most intimate places in a home, a master bedroom could definitely benefit from a cozy floor covering. Aside from keeping your feet cozy, floor coverings are also perfect design tools for showing off your personal style.

A carefully selected rug will help tie the room together and define the space while also reducing noise and helping your floors remain free from scratches and scuffs.

Achieve a high-end look with custom built-ins

A dream master bedroom means different things for different people, but if there is one feature we can all agree a bedroom should have, it has to be storage. A great place to hide all the clutter and keep everything clean and tidy, efficient storage space is a must-have when it comes to modern homes. Instead of purchasing storage furniture, many homeowners nowadays choose to invest in custom built-ins for their master bedrooms.

Not only are these add-ons an excellent way to save precious space, but they can also give your home a more higher-end look. Since they are custom, you can easily come up with a design that meets all your needs, whether you need extra space for storing your clothes or want to have a television cabinet (or both!).

Boost your bedroom’s functionality by making necessary upgrades

Tackling a bedroom remodel is also a chance for you to improve your master bedroom’s functionality. In an ideal modern home family house layout, each bedroom comes with a bathroom. Even though this is not always the case, that doesn’t mean you can’t do anything about it. If you’re working with a larger master bedroom, you can use the extra space to create a smaller bathroom.

On the other hand, if the master bedroom feels small, your remodeling project can be seen as an opportunity to expand the existing square footage. Knocking down an exterior wall can be a great way to expand your master bedroom, but if that’s not possible, a good alternative would be to expand into an adjacent room. While the latter option won’t be adding any extra square footage, the extra space in both cases can be used for making valuable upgrades such as walk-in closets which can potentially increase home value.
